Blood Composition: What Solids Don't Contain

Blood Composition: What Solids Don't Contain

When you think about blood, do you picture a homogeneous red liquid? Well, here's the kicker: cellular components only make up about 45% of its volume. The remaining 55%? That's plasma - the liquid matrix carrying everything from hormones to waste products.

Silicon-Based Solids: Energy Storage Breakthroughs

Silicon-Based Solids: Energy Storage Breakthroughs

Ever wondered why silicon-based solids keep appearing in every renewable energy discussion? The answer lies in their unique atomic structure - each silicon atom bonds with four neighbors, creating a stable lattice that's perfect for electron management. Recent data shows silicon anodes could boost lithium-ion battery capacity by 40% compared to traditional graphite designs.

Do All Metallic Solids Conduct Electricity?

Do All Metallic Solids Conduct Electricity?

Let's cut through the noise: metallic solids generally conduct electricity, but it's not a universal rule. The secret lies in atomic structure—specifically, how easily electrons can move. Picture copper wiring in your house: those free electrons zip through the metal like commuters catching the 8:15 train.

Ionic Solids: Powering Energy Storage

Ionic Solids: Powering Energy Storage

You know, ionic solids aren't just lab curiosities - they're the unsung heroes in your smartphone battery. These materials consist of positively and negatively charged ions locked in a rigid 3D lattice through electrostatic forces. Take sodium chloride (NaCl), for instance. Each cubic centimeter contains about 10²² sodium and chloride ions arranged in alternating positions.
